Solution for -1+14+x=-6+8 equation:


Simplifying
-1 + 14 + x = -6 + 8

Combine like terms: -1 + 14 = 13
13 + x = -6 + 8

Combine like terms: -6 + 8 = 2
13 + x = 2

Solving
13 + x = 2

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-13' to each side of the equation.
13 + -13 + x = 2 + -13

Combine like terms: 13 + -13 = 0
0 + x = 2 + -13
x = 2 + -13

Combine like terms: 2 + -13 = -11
x = -11

Simplifying
x = -11
